What is ADHD?
ADHD is defined by persistent patterns of in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sivity. These behaviors can significantly affect an individual's scholastic, social, and occupational functioning. Although ADHD is often detected in youth, it can continue into their adult years, often presenting different challenges.
Symptoms of ADHD
Symptoms of ADHD can be categorized broadly into two types: inattention and hyperactivity-impulsivity.
Negligence:
Difficulty sustaining attention in tasksOften loses items required for jobsDifficulty arranging jobs and activitiesEasily sidetracked by extraneous stimuli
Hyperactivity and Impulsivity:
Fidgeting or tapping hands or feetTalking exceedinglyInterrupting or invading others' discussionsDifficulty waiting for one's turn
Acknowledging these symptoms early is important, as ADHD can affect academic results, social relationships, and total lifestyle.

What to Expect From a Private ADHD Assessment in Edinburgh
A private ADHD assessment generally follows a number of core parts:
Initial Consultation: This meeting involves discussing symptoms, case history, and any previous assessments. It is necessary for the clinician to comprehend the person's specific experiences.
Questionnaires and Rating Scales: Patients might be asked to finish standardized rating scales to assess the seriousness of their symptoms and their impact on everyday functioning.
Scientific Interview: An in-depth scientific interview is generally carried out to collect comprehensive information regarding household history, social interactions, and scholastic or occupational performance.
Observations: In some cases, clinicians may ask for interaction observations, specifically for children, to assess behaviors in various settings.
Feedback Session: After the evaluation is complete, the clinician will provide feedback, discussing the results and prospective treatment options, consisting of medication and behavior modifications.
